Least Common Multiple of 20787 and 20804 with GCF Formula

The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 20787 and 20804, than apply into the LCM equation.

GCF(20787,20804) = 1
LCM(20787,20804) = ( 20787 × 20804) / 1
LCM(20787,20804) = 432452748 / 1
LCM(20787,20804) = 432452748
